Carloto Cotta waives education and will be judged in a case of violation

The defense of Carloto Cotta has decided to forgo the preliminary phase in his case, which involves nine charges including rape and kidnapping, leading it to proceed to trial. The proceedings will soon be submitted for trial after being assigned to a group of judges who will set its commencement date.

The charges include rape, kidnapping, physical assault, threats, and insults against a woman whom the actor allegedly held captive for over a day in a house in Colares, Sintra.

It is noteworthy that the preliminary phase is optional and is meant to demonstrate if the evidence collected by the Public Prosecutor is insufficient for a conviction.

From “shopping” to being trapped at home: What happened?

The incident came to light at the end of February, after which the Public Prosecutor elaborated on the investigation. It was revealed that Carloto Cotta and the 40-year-old victim met at a shopping mall in January 2023 and exchanged messages for five months.

They eventually met at the actor’s home, and upon entering, “the accused locked the door.” With the woman inside the house, the suspect “expressed his intent for a sexual encounter,” which the victim declined, requesting to leave. However, the actor allegedly proceeded with “sexual advances, culminating in assault and violation of the victim.”

Beyond the rape and assaults, the actor reportedly threatened the victim with death, even going to “the kitchen to fetch a knife.”

At that point, the woman managed to reach a window, from which she “jumped into the public street” seeking help, resulting in “bruises, contusions, and scratches” on her body due to the “actions of the accused.”

Carloto Cotta, who holds French nationality but has lived in Portugal for several years, is a well-known actor recognizable from his roles in soap operas, films, theater plays, and international series, such as Netflix’s ‘Elite.’ In 2009, he starred in João Salaviza’s film ‘Arena,’ which won the Palme d’Or for short films at the Cannes Film Festival.
